
The average Combined Insurance Media Buyer earns an estimated $55,558 annually. Combined Insurance's Media Buyer compensation is $9,009 less than the US average for a Media Buyer.
The Marketing Department at Combined Insurance earns $14,563 more on average than the HR Department.

Media Buyers earn $2,665 less than Marketing Associates.
The Marketing Department averages $14,563 more than the HR Department, and $6,083 less than the Engineering Department
The average female Media Buyer at companies similar size to Combined Insurance reported making $51,500, while the average male Media Buyer at similar sized companies reported making $73,367.
The average Asian or Pacific Islander Media Buyer at companies similar size to Combined Insurance reported making $95,000, while the average Caucasian Media Buyer at similar sized companies reported making $52,025.
The majority of Media Buyers at Combined Insurance believe they're not compensated fairly. 100% of Media Buyers at Combined Insurance say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(67%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Combined Insurance
